 216/*
 217 * The per-object header is a pretty dense thing, which is
 218 *  - first byte: low four bits are "size", then three bits of "type",
 219 *    and the high bit is "size continues".
 220 *  - each byte afterwards: low seven bits are size continuation,
 221 *    with the high bit being "size continues"
 222 */
 223static int encode_header(enum object_type type, unsigned long size, unsigned char *hdr)
 224{
 225        int n = 1;
 226        unsigned char c;
 227
 228        if (type < OBJ_COMMIT || type > OBJ_DELTA)
 229                die("bad type %d", type);
 230
 231        c = (type << 4) | (size & 15);
 232        size >>= 4;
 233        while (size) {
 234                *hdr++ = c | 0x80;
 235                c = size & 0x7f;
 236                size >>= 7;
 237                n++;
 238        }
 239        *hdr = c;
 240        return n;
 241}

 999/*
1000 * We search for deltas _backwards_ in a list sorted by type and
1001 * by size, so that we see progressively smaller and smaller files.
1002 * That's because we prefer deltas to be from the bigger file
1003 * to the smaller - deletes are potentially cheaper, but perhaps
1004 * more importantly, the bigger file is likely the more recent
1005 * one.
1006 */
1007static int try_delta(struct unpacked *cur, struct unpacked *old, unsigned max_depth)
1008{
1009        struct object_entry *cur_entry = cur->entry;
1010        struct object_entry *old_entry = old->entry;
1011        unsigned long size, oldsize, delta_size, sizediff;
1012        long max_size;
1013        void *delta_buf;
1014
1015        /* Don't bother doing diffs between different types */
1016        if (cur_entry->type != old_entry->type)
1017                return -1;
1018
1019        /* We do not compute delta to *create* objects we are not
1020         * going to pack.
1021         */
1022        if (cur_entry->preferred_base)
1023                return -1;
1024
1025        /* If the current object is at pack edge, take the depth the
1026         * objects that depend on the current object into account --
1027         * otherwise they would become too deep.
1028         */
1029        if (cur_entry->delta_child) {
1030                if (max_depth <= cur_entry->delta_limit)
1031                        return 0;
1032                max_depth -= cur_entry->delta_limit;
1033        }
1034
1035        size = cur_entry->size;
1036        oldsize = old_entry->size;
1037        sizediff = oldsize > size ? oldsize - size : size - oldsize;
1038
1039        if (size < 50)
1040                return -1;
1041        if (old_entry->depth >= max_depth)
1042                return 0;
1043
1044        /*
1045         * NOTE!
1046         *
1047         * We always delta from the bigger to the smaller, since that's
1048         * more space-efficient (deletes don't have to say _what_ they
1049         * delete).
1050         */
1051        max_size = size / 2 - 20;
1052        if (cur_entry->delta)
1053                max_size = cur_entry->delta_size-1;
1054        if (sizediff >= max_size)
1055                return -1;
1056        delta_buf = diff_delta(old->data, oldsize,
1057                               cur->data, size, &delta_size, max_size);
1058        if (!delta_buf)
1059                return 0;
1060        cur_entry->delta = old_entry;
1061        cur_entry->delta_size = delta_size;
1062        cur_entry->depth = old_entry->depth + 1;
1063        free(delta_buf);
1064        return 0;
1065}
